Clog removal services involve the professional clearing of blockages within residential or commercial plumbing systems to restore proper flow. These services typically address issues such as slow draining sinks, toilets that won’t flush, or water backing up in tubs and showers. Service providers use specialized tools and techniques to locate and eliminate obstructions like hair, grease, soap scum, mineral buildup, or foreign objects that can cause clogs. Regular clog removal can help prevent more serious plumbing problems, reduce the risk of water damage, and ensure that household drains function efficiently.

The overview below groups typical Clog Removal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Independence, MO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ine clog removal jobs in Independence, MO typically cost between $150 and $300. These include clearing minor blockages in sinks, toilets, or small drains, which are common for local contractors. Costs generally fall within this range for straightforward issues.
Moderate Clogs - More involved projects, such as larger drain cleanings or partial pipe repairs, often range from $300 to $600. Many local service providers handle these types of jobs regularly within this middle tier, though some larger or more complex projects can approach $1,000.
Severe Blockages - Extensive clogs requiring specialized equipment or partial pipe replacements can cost between $600 and $1,500. Fewer projects reach this high end, but when they do, they often involve significant work in older or heavily congested plumbing systems.
Full Pipe Replacement - Complete replacement of damaged or severely deteriorated pipes can exceed $5,000, depending on the extent of the work. These larger, more complex projects are less common but are handled by experienced local contractors for extensive clog-related issues.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a drain to become clogged? Common causes include the buildup of hair, grease, soap scum, or debris that accumulates over time and blocks the flow of water in pipes.
How can I tell if my drain is clogged? Signs of a clog include slow draining water, gurgling sounds, or water backing up in sinks or tubs, indicating a blockage in the plumbing system.
What methods do local contractors use to remove clogs? They typically use techniques such as drain snaking, hydro jetting, or augering to clear blockages and restore proper drain function.
Are chemical drain cleaners recommended for clog removal? Chemical cleaners are generally not recommended as they can damage pipes and may not effectively resolve all types of clogs; professional methods are often preferred.
How can I prevent future drain clogs? Regularly avoiding pouring grease down drains, using drain screens to catch debris, and scheduling routine maintenance can help reduce the likelihood of clogs.
